Race is a classification that relies on physical markers. Which of the following is true?
 
  1. In the United States, children of biracial parents are usually assigned the race of the father.
  2. Ethnicity and race are synonymous terms.
  3. Individuals may be of the same race but of different cultures.
  4. No social significance is usually placed on race.

Answer to Question 2

3
It is often a misconception that persons of the same race have the same culture. For example, African Americans may have been born in Africa, the Caribbean, North America or elsewhere and have very different cultures.

Bisphosphonates were first developed in the nineteenth century. They were first investigated for use in disorders of bone metabolism in the 1960s. They are now used clinically for the treatment of osteoporosis, Paget's disease, bone metastasis, multiple myeloma, and other conditions that feature bone fragility.
